Upkeep is not just about preventative measures; it also involves following manufacturer guidelines regarding service intervals and operational checks. Schedule maintenance ensures that any early signs of wear and tear are addressed promptly. This proactive approach not only enhances efficiency but can also contribute to improved safety. A well-maintained boiler is less likely to malfunction, thus reducing the risk of dangerous situations arising from faulty equipment.

Choosing an energy-efficient boiler can significantly reduce your long-term energy bills. Modern models are designed with advanced technology that maximises fuel efficiency, leading to substantial savings over time. When selecting a boiler, consider its energy rating; models with higher ratings consume less energy and have a lower environmental impact. The initial investment for condensing boilers tends to be higher than that of traditional boilers. This difference in cost can be attributed to the advanced technology and additional components required for condensing models. However, the increased efficiency of condensing boilers often results in lower energy bills. Long-term savings associated with condensing boilers become evident through reduced fuel consumption and improved energy efficiency. Households may experience lower heating costs, particularly during colder months when heating demand peaks. The overall lifespan of condensing boilers can also contribute to cost-effectiveness, as they typically have a longer operational life compared to traditional models. The environmental impact of condensing boilers is significantly lower than that of traditional boilers. These modern units operate by extracting heat from the flue gases, which would otherwise be wasted. This efficiency leads to decreased fuel consumption, resulting in lower carbon dioxide emissions. Over time, the cumulative effect of fewer emissions can greatly contribute to reducing the overall carbon footprint associated with heating.
